Phthalocyanine Blue BGS (P.B.15:3)
◐Phthalocyanine Blue BGS is an organic pigment that exhibits a deep blue color with a greenish undertone. It features vibrant and pure color, excellent dispersibility, outstanding stability, and extremely strong tinting strength.

3.Product Parameters
CAS Number | 147-14-8 |
Molecular Formula | C32H16CuN8 |
Hue | Green Shade Blue |
Relative Density | 1.60 g/cm³ |
Bulk Density | 13.1 – 14.7 lb/gal |
Particle Shape | Rod-like (Monoclinic) |
Average Particle Size | 78 μm |
Oil Absorption | 30 – 80 g/100 g |
Melting Poin | 480°C(decomposes) |
pH Value (10% slurry) | 5.5 – 8.0 |
Specific Surface Area | 38 – 95 m²/g |
Lightfastness | 7 |
Heat Resistance | 300°C |
Acid Resistance | 5 |
Alkali Resistance | 5 |
